iOS 4.3.2 to Fix Verizon iPad 2 Connectivity, FaceTime Issues
BGR has managed to obtain an early copy of the iOS 4.3.2 update and claims it is due in the next week or so.
One of our Apple sources has just let us know that Apples iOS 4.3.2, due within the next week or so, will fix the issues weve been hearing about with some Verizon iPad 2 models. Additionally, the new update is said to contain a fix for FaceTime in addition to security fixes for things like WebKit vulnerabilities and other minor changes.
BGR has reportedly installed it on their phone and we'll update this post if they find any other changes. Apple had previously stated they were looking into the Verizon connectivity issue which was causing some customers problems connecting on 3G.
